2016-09-29 35 views
0

我有这个代码的导航栏都完美的作品,但是当我尝试用图像替换文本图像不显示。如何使用bootstrap添加图像?

下面的代码:

<a href="#" class="dropdown-toggle" data-toggle="dropdown"><img src="DAR.png" class="img-responsive"><b class="caret"></b></a> 
           <ul class="dropdown-menu"> 
            <li><a href="#">Sign-in</a></li> 
            <li><a href="#">Sign-up</a></li> 
           </ul> 

回答

0

您可以添加内部链接的图像。看看这个fiddle。并确保图像的路径是正确的。如果路径是正确的,它应该工作。我现在改变了你的形象和工作。

<a href="#" class="dropdown-toggle" data-toggle="dropdown"><img src="https://s13.postimg.org/pzvk4df07/1475139047_three_bars.png" class="img-responsive"><b class="caret"></b></a> 
          <ul class="dropdown-menu"> 
           <li><a href="#">Sign-in</a></li> 
           <li><a href="#">Sign-up</a></li> 
          </ul> 
+0

我试过你的代码,它工作..感谢 – Trojan

+0

高兴地帮助你。 – Sasith

0

我想你想的图像添加到您的导航栏。如果是这样,您需要在导航中添加带有CSS的图像。删除你的IMG链接。你可以这样做:

<a href="#" class="dropdown-toggle" id="nav"data-toggle="dropdown"><b class="caret"></b></a> 
          <ul class="dropdown-menu"> 
           <li><a href="#">Sign-in</a></li> 
           <li><a href="#">Sign-up</a></li> 
          </ul> 

里面你的CSS补充一点:

#nav { 
background-image:url('DAR.png'); 
}